LC57 URG is a 2007 Yamaha FJR1300A in Silver with a 1,298c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 75%.
Across all 2007 Yamaha FJR1300A models, the average MOT pass rate is 90.2% with a typical mileage of 26,163 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Yamaha FJR1300A fails its MOT is shock absorber seal failed and leaking oil, accounting for 317 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LC57 URG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Yamaha FJR1300A typ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 19 years old, this Yamaha FJR1300A is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
